For $19.99 a month, Sony PlayStation 4 games will be playable on your Windows PC

Sony’s PlayStation Now (PS Now) game streaming service for PlayStation 4 (PS4) and Windows has finally added support for PS4 games. The library is now 500+ titles strong.Card-carrying members of the #PCMasterRace will be excited to hear the news because as we all know, Sony has some incredible titles in its library.The PS Now service is a $19.99 a month ($99.99 a year) service that will let you stream PlayStation games to your PC over the internet. The library was limited to PS3 games earlier, which is still good, but the inclusion of PS4 games now means that some incredible PlayStation-exclusive titles like Bloodborne, Horizon: Zero Dawn and Uncharted 4 have a chance of appearing on PC.Right now, Sony has added 20 PS4 games to the PS Now services. The entire list of titles is as follows:
- Killzone Shadow Fall
- God of War 3 Remastered
- Saints Row IV: Re-Elected
- WWE 2K16
- Tropico 5
- Ultra Street Fighter IV
- F1 2015
- Darksiders II Deathinitive Edition
- Evolve
- MX vs ATV Supercross Encore
- Resogun
- Helldivers
- Broken Age
- Dead Nation: Apocalypse Edition
- Grim Fandango Remastered
- Akiba’s Beat
- Castlestorm Definitive Edition
- Exist Archive: The Other Side of the Sky
- Nidhogg
- Super Mega Baseball
